Wine Enthusiast
- we93
This is a strong, classically styled bottling by Marlborough stalwart Jules Taylor. A heady combo of pineapple, passionfruit and grass is underscored by dried herbs. It flows to a palate that's crisp, dry and peachy right to the finish. Easy sipping with lovely balance, tension and textural weight for food friendliness.
James Suckling
- js91
Vibrant and fresh aromas of passion fruit, cut grass and pineapple. The light-bodied palate has a creamy mouthfeel and focused acidity, giving notes of peaches, nectarines and lychees. Tropical fruit-driven with a generous texture. Drink now. Screw cap.
Vinous
- v89
The 2024 Sauvignon Blanc is ripe and rounded with well-balanced acidity that refreshes but doesn't dominate the wine, allowing the fruit to shine. Expect mango, passion fruit and nectarine-like fruit flavors with a gourmand texture on the medium-length finish. Enjoy this in youth for its fleshy fruit and freshness.
